Socialism’s a Good Thing
Watch as Larry and Bill try their darndest to remove any stigma from socialism: From The Blaze: Lawrence O’Donnell Explains His Brand of Socialism: ‘I Hate Bad Socialism’
Watch as Larry and Bill try their darndest to remove any stigma from socialism: From The Blaze: Lawrence O’Donnell Explains His Brand of Socialism: ‘I Hate Bad Socialism’
When I was growing up this guy would not have been on TV. A self avowed socialist, apparently Lawrence O’Donnell is also an atheist (no surprise there) who not only…